10. Head-to-Head
Brady and Rodgers have enjoyed long NFL careers. But incredibly they’ve only played four times against each other. As they play in different conferences the opportunities are slim. However, Brady has the upper hand when it comes to their head-to-head record. His teams have beaten Rodgers three times with a single defeat. Of course, it’s not entirely fair to base their performances on the results.

Football is a team sport but the quarterback has the potential to change the sport. Their most recent clash saw the Bucs send the Packers out of the 2020 playoffs. In the end, Brady continued his winning record as he continued to outclass Rodgers. The Packers QB had a lot of motivation because this was about legacy. But Brady and his team were relentless in pursuit of victory (via Forbes).
